Description

Diisopropyl (4R,5R)-1,3,2-Dioxathiolane- 4,5-Dica.La.Dioxide is a high-purity chiral sulfite ester derivative. This compound is valued for its role as a key chiral intermediate and ligand in asymmetric synthesis, enabling the production of enantiomerically pure pharmaceuticals and fine chemicals. It is primarily sought by research institutions and manufacturers in the pharmaceutical, agrochemical, and advanced material sectors for developing novel active ingredients and catalysts.

Application

  • As a chiral auxiliary or ligand in asymmetric catalytic reactions, including oxidations and C-C bond formations.
  • Key intermediate in pharmaceutical synthesis for the development of enantiomerically pure active pharmaceutical ingredients (APIs).
  • Use in agrochemical research for creating chiral pesticides and herbicides with improved efficacy and selectivity.
  • Application in material science for the synthesis of specialized polymers and liquid crystals.
  • As a building block in organic and medicinal chemistry research for novel compound libraries.
  • Potential use in the synthesis of flavors, fragrances, and other fine chemicals requiring high stereochemical control.

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ated area at controlled room temperature (15-25°C). Due to its hygroscopic nature, the container must be kept tightly sealed to exclude moisture. Keep away from incompatible materials such as strong bases and reducing agents.
